MineColonies

MineColonies

53M Downloads

[BUG] Couriers end up in loop when warehouse is upgraded

kezmodius opened this issue ยท 1 comments

commented

Is there an existing issue for this?

  • I have searched the existing issues

Are you using the latest MineColonies Version?

  • I am running the latest alpha version of MineColonies for my Minecraft version.

Did you check on the Wiki? or ask on Discord?

  • I checked the MineColonies Wiki and made sure my issue is not covered there. Or I was sent from discord to open an issue here.

What were you playing at the time? Were you able to reproduce it in both settings?

  • Single Player
  • Multi Player

Minecraft Version

1.20.1

MineColonies Version

1.1.396-BETA

Structurize Version

1.0.675-BETA

Related Mods and their Versions

Forge - 47.2.19
A Sorcerers Journey modpack (modlist in log below)

Current Behavior

Shire style. Upgrading to Level 5 warehouse. Most of the couriers are running in circles in the additional courier hut. They all have tasks but are not doing them, including a delivery to the builder upgrading the warehouse. They also did this on upgrading to level 3 warehouse but they were running in circles on the other side of the building. I had to complete the deliveries myself and it seems I will have to again. If I recall them to their hut they leg it back to the spot immediately. They only stop to go sleep and then they come back and run in circles again. I reset the request system but it did not stop the behaviour.

Expected Behavior

To deliver/pick up as per their task list

Reproduction Steps

  1. Build a shire warehouse (I don't know if it happens with others though - I have seen complaints of this same behaviour on main discord)
  2. Level up to 3 - during upgrade observe no deliveries occurring and couriers running in circles.
  3. I did not notice an issue at levelling up to levels 2 or 4.
  4. Level up to 5 - during upgrade observe 2 couriers doing normal deliveries and the remaining couriers running in circles.

Logs

https://gist.github.com/kezmodius/c778c5c7727f610cc3ff140fbc782f51

Anything else?

I think this has been an intermittent problem for a year at least. I have observed similar behaviour when I did the Steampunk build but that was before you changed their idle animation, so they just stood near the hutblock (but outside the building) and stopped working and the colony screeched to a halt and I had to do all the deliveries until the warehouse completed upgrading.

This person on discord seemed to have the same issue: https://discord.com/channels/139070364159311872/1125094832143077456/1186091124360753193

This is where they are running.
2024-01-06_12 28 13

2024-01-06_13 16 40
After a restart (to get the log above) only two couriers remained running in circles including Fred Noakes who needs to deliver obsidian to the builder to finish the warehouse.
2024-01-06_13 18 11

  • Add a thumbs-up to the bug report if you are also affected. This helps the bug report become more visible to the team and doesn't clutter the comments.
  • Add a comment if you have any insights or background information that isn't already part of the conversation.
commented

I went to get the obsidian to deliver it myself and it may be in an inaccessible part of the warehouse.
2024-01-06_13 25 37
I guess that explains it but I don't know how to fix it!